OSDN Git Service

Eleven: Complete Apollo rebrand.
[android-x86/packages-apps-Eleven.git] / Android.mk
1 LOCAL_PATH:= $(call my-dir)
2 include $(CLEAR_VARS)
3
4 LOCAL_MODULE_TAGS := optional
5
6 LOCAL_SRC_FILES := src/org/lineageos/eleven/IElevenService.aidl
7 LOCAL_SRC_FILES += $(call all-java-files-under, src)
8
9 LOCAL_RESOURCE_DIR := $(addprefix $(LOCAL_PATH)/, res) \
10     $(TOP)/frameworks/support/v7/cardview/res \
11     $(TOP)/frameworks/support/v7/recyclerview/res
12
13 LOCAL_STATIC_JAVA_LIBRARIES := \
14     android-support-v8-renderscript \
15     android-support-v7-palette \
16     android-support-v7-cardview \
17     android-common \
18     android-support-v4 \
19     android-support-v7-recyclerview \
20     guava \
21     junit
22
23 LOCAL_AAPT_FLAGS := \
24     --auto-add-overlay \
25     --extra-packages android.support.v7.cardview \
26     --extra-packages android.support.v7.recyclerview
27
28 LOCAL_PACKAGE_NAME := Eleven
29 LOCAL_OVERRIDES_PACKAGES := Music
30
31 LOCAL_PRIVILEGED_MODULE := true
32
33 LOCAL_JNI_SHARED_LIBRARIES := librsjni
34
35 LOCAL_PROGUARD_FLAGS := -include $(LOCAL_PATH)/proguard.cfg
36 ifeq ($(TARGET_BUILD_VARIANT),user)
37     LOCAL_PROGUARD_ENABLED := obfuscation
38 else
39     LOCAL_PROGUARD_ENABLED := disabled
40 endif
41
42 include $(BUILD_PACKAGE)
43
44 include $(CLEAR_VARS)
45
46 include $(BUILD_MULTI_PREBUILT)